When it comes to business though, ‘anything goes’ is not a good idea.

You start your own business because you’re fed up with seeing someone else benefit from your labours, or after redundancy there are few other options. You’re good at something, building, beauty therapy, dog training, cooking for example; or you’re a professional; accountant, lawyer, or a medico and you decide to give it a go. You are not necessarily good at, or professionally qualified in running a business.

Very few are like me when I set out on my own. My business IS business administration.

Whatever the reason you start, being your own boss does not mean that anything goes.

You learn pretty quickly that the Taxman has other ideas, so do the bankers. Suppliers, customers, staff, accountants, they all have their demands and you find yourself, at best, juggling too many balls for comfort. The happy dream of being your own boss and doing things your way becomes a distant memory.
